## Deploying the Gatewick Proctor Queue

Deploys are pretty painless: push to main, wait for the pipeline, then watch the queue drain dashboard for five minutes. If candidates pile up mid-exam, roll back first and ask questions later — the queue replays safely. Everything the workers care about lives in one config block, shown here for reference.

settings of bafof-yagef:
JOROX_PIN=8740
JOROX_TENANT=pelox
JOROX_METRICS_HOST=metrics.jorox.qorvelworks.internal
JOROX_SEAL=seal_c78f63c1
JOROX_STANDBY_TEAM=norax

Heads up, plugin folks: the Larchwire event schema registry validates every payload you publish, so register your schemas before shipping. Breaking changes need a new version, not an in-place edit — the registry will reject those anyway. To point your local plugin harness at the sandbox registry, use the connection settings shown below.

settings of yageg-yahap:
[gorael]
team = olieth
access_code = ac_941d74
owner = brieth.aldiel
host = gorael.tolvaqio.internal
port = 6379
peer = briwyn.urlaqtech.internal
salt = 116e6622
pin = 1957

Retrying failed exports (Lantermill Pipeline). Exports that fail with a transient error are retried three times with exponential backoff; anything else lands in the manual-retry bucket. To reprocess, run the requeue script against the bucket name — never against the live queue. Retries are idempotent because exports key on batch ID. If the requeue tool prompts for vault unlock, it needs the recovery passphrase, which appears directly below.

unlock words, yawig-kagef: gordor-holvan-ulaael-pramir-ulaiel-tamdor